Default Cottage garden plant recommendations

I live in Southern Calif,bordeline zones 22/23, according to the
Sunset Western garden book. I have a sunny area that gets lots of
water,due to flooding in the winter.I can control the watering in the
Summer though.I'd like some cottage plants-blues,whites, and pinks.The
area is about 3' deep and approx. 12' long. Right now i have a
planting of 2 Iceberg roses, mixed with some Lavenders, Dianthus, and
Delphiniums, but need more plants to fill the area. Any suggestions?
The plants shouldn't get more than 2'-3' tall. Thanks!
